Calendar year

In the Gregorian calendar in common use, the calendar year begins on January 1, and ends on December 31. Other alignments of the 12-month period can be used for purposes of accounting (see fiscal year).

More generally, a calendar year begins on the New Year's day of the given calendar system and ends on the day before the following New Year's day.
